Two Wyandanch men facing up to 25 years in prison for kidnapping, robbing taxi driver of $60

James Davender and Antoine Sims could spend up to 25 years in prison if convicted.

Two 20-year-old Wyandanch men have been indicted for allegedly kidnapping and robbing a taxi driver who was driving them from Queens to Long Island.

James Davender and Antoine Sims could spend up to 25 years in prison if convicted.

Investigators found that on April 22, the pair ordered a taxi to take them from Far Rockaway to Wyandanch. During the ride, Davender allegedly started yelling and cursing at the driver while trying to grab the steering wheel, causing the car to swerve. They both are also accused of moving the gear shift into park to try and repeatedly stop the car.

Prosecutors say Davender then threatened the driver with a folding knife and demanded his wallet. When the driver refused, Sims allegedly reached into his pocket and took about $60.
